		<description><![CDATA[Don&#8217;t despair if your steam iron doesn&#8217;t steam. Quite often, mineral deposits in the water clog the vents, and a simple treatment can solve the problem. Fill the water reservoir with white vinegar. Heat the iron and set it on a cake or broiler rack while it steams a few minutes.
